CNN has lost its market position not to a competitor but to the structural collapse of cable itself—it's now third among cable news outlets while the entire cable ecosystem contracts. The prestige news brand built on 24-hour coverage finds itself trapped in a medium audiences are abandoning, making its cable ranking almost academic. CNN represents the terminal decline of institutional TV news as a cultural reference point, leaving a power vacuum that partisan cable (Fox, MSNBC) and digital platforms are filling on their own ideological terms.
